请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

老师,代码在visualstudio中没问题,但是在jerkins中提示ImportError: No module named 'data',这是什么原因?

正在回答 回答被采纳积分+3

1回答

Mushishi 2019-05-15 19:26:08

这个你把你的工程目录添加到你jenkins中去,当做项目目录

0 回复 有任何疑惑可以回复我~
  • 提问者 Park_玺源 #1
    我添加执行目录main下了,但还是不可以。我总出现引入包错误的提示,包里有__init__.py这个文件啊,为什么总是提示引入包错误??
    -----------------------------------------------------------------------
    失败控制台输出
    由用户 admin 启动
    构建中 在工作空间 E:/ApiProject/main 中
    [main] $ cmd /c call C:\WINDOWS\TEMP\jenkins4475356478788829154.bat
    
    E:\ApiProject\main>python run_main.py 
    Traceback (most recent call last):
      File "run_main.py", line 1, in <module>
        from data.get_data import GetData
    ImportError: No module named 'data'
    
    E:\ApiProject\main>exit 1 
    Build step '执行 Windows 批处理命令' marked build as failure
    Finished: FAILURE
    回复 有任何疑惑可以回复我~ 2019-05-16 10:02:30
  • 提问者 Park_玺源 #2
    老师,我找到原因了,在系统管理--全局属性--环境变量中加入工程目录就好了。我之前只在工程任务的管理中加入的工程目录。
    回复 有任何疑惑可以回复我~ 2019-05-16 10:37:14
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信